Transaction f70b57c38d613143ba3a4a96cb49350924dc28b19505dfc62753b0a28e118cbc

30 Input
2 Outputs
  • f70b57c38d613143ba3a4a96cb49350924dc28b19505dfc62753b0a28e118cbc:0
  • value  213567183
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• f70b57c38d613143ba3a4a96cb49350924dc28b19505dfc62753b0a28e118cbc:1
  • value  977136
    address  32mRTeFnEafgwvbzCFaC7ovPZrdwRzQxLD